Tennessee Titans Direct Contracting Opportunities for the New Stadium Project

Overview of Titans / Owner Direct Opportunities

While most contracting opportunities will fall under the TBA’s Construction Management Agreement, there are also opportunities that will be procured directly by the Tennessee Titans. These opportunities range from signage, to FF&E, to supporting infrastructure projects, and this page will outline RFP announcements and instructions.

Opportunity: Request for Proposals for New Stadium Video Production System, including delegated design and engineering, furnish, and installation – Open Fall 2025

Work under this Contract includes all labor, materials, tools, transportation services, supervision, coordination, etc., necessary to complete the installation of the Video Production System, as described in these specifications and illustrated on the associated drawings. The systems shall be called the “Video Production System” and the installer the “Video Production Installer”. The systems include the following major items:

  1. Video Control Room Technology

  2. All electrical distribution within each system at each installation point

  3. Technical millwork and furniture consoles

The nature of the contract is “design-build”. The installer is responsible for all subsequent design and engineering (delegated design) not included within the RFP documents. The Installer is responsible for providing all components necessary for a complete and operational system.
